The OJJDP's Comprehensive Strategy for Serious, Violent, and Chronic Juvenile Offenders program is most likely to target d) Chronic and serious juvenile offenders. This program aims to address the issue of the increasing number of juveniles committing serious crimes and the failure of facilities to rehabilitate them effectively, resulting in a continuous cycle of criminal behavior.
According to social disorganization theory, crime is likely to occur in environments where there are weak social ties and a lack of social control, which could contribute to serious and chronic violations by juveniles. Thus, targeted interventions and strategies, like the OJJDP's program, focus on this demographic with the intention of breaking the cycle of crime and offering a pathway towards rehabilitation.
